Transaction 32e172d1434a02e8a6ccd934113f503326ec91b98971df3fd7480bbe417d7752

1 Input
2 Outputs
  • 32e172d1434a02e8a6ccd934113f503326ec91b98971df3fd7480bbe417d7752:0
  • value  43432000
    address  38hHHYEQS9zPPqgEeZTAJTVNcc4Mnthya9
  • 32e172d1434a02e8a6ccd934113f503326ec91b98971df3fd7480bbe417d7752:1
  • value  758075600
    address  1KWVXJTSF5d1cq2miK2YYL75gAGEwLbxmg